What people receive

A Stay Nimble account for life

Career support people can use in their own time: Ask.Nim at any hour, Skills Finder, Career Explorer, Course Finder, CV Helper and Job Radar.

Funded places include coaching credit with a coach registered with the Career Development Institute, qualified to at least Level 6 in career guidance and trained as a mental health first aider. Coaching credit does not expire, so nobody is penalised for stepping away and coming back.

Corbett Community Library, Lewisham

Career support inside a place people already use

Over 100 local people have worked with us at the library since December 2023. More than 40 have moved into full-time work, part-time work or self-employment, or taken a significant step through volunteering or vocational training.

Cordelia Wise RCDP spends about a third of her week with Stay Nimble there. The rest she coaches by video across the country.

Stay Nimble is a social enterprise providing free career support to people on low or no income, funded through public contracts, social value commitments, grants and our own reinvested surplus.
